#d99f9e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d99f9e is composed of 85.1% red, 62.4%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.7% magenta, 27.2%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 1 degrees, a saturation of 43.7% and a lightness of 73.5%. #d99f9e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b33f3d.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#d99f9e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#faf3f3 is the lightest one.
